Abstract

BACKGROUND

Postpartum runners report musculoskeletal pain with running. Because of inadequate research, little is known about the origin and pain-related classification. Through expert consensus, this study is the first attempt to understand the musculoskeletal impairments that these runners present with. The objective of this survey was to gather expert consensus on characteristics of reported impairments in postpartum runners that have musculoskeletal pain.

METHODS

A web-based Delphi survey was conducted and was composed of five categories: strength, range of motion, alignment and flexibility impairments, as well as risk factors for pain in postpartum runners.

RESULTS

A total of 117 experts were invited. Forty-five experts completed round I and forty-one completed rounds II and III. The strength impairments that reached consensus were abdominal, hip and pelvic floor muscle weakness. The range of motion impairments that reached consensus were hip extension restriction, anterior pelvic tilt and general hypermobility. The alignment impairments that reached consensus were a Trendelenburg sign, dynamic knee valgus, lumbar lordosis, over-pronation and thoracic kyphosis. The flexibility impairments that reached consensus were abdominal wall laxity, and tightness in hip flexors, lumbar extensors, iliotibial band and hamstrings. The risk factors for pain in postpartum runners were muscular imbalance, poor lumbopelvic control, too much too soon, life stressors, pain during pregnancy and pelvic floor trauma.

CONCLUSION

This study presents a framework for clinicians to understand pain in postpartum runners and that can be investigated in future cohort studies.

摘要

背景

产后跑步者报告称跑步时存在肌肉骨骼疼痛。由于研究不足,对于其疼痛起源及相关分类知之甚少。通过专家共识,本研究首次尝试了解这些跑步者所呈现的肌肉骨骼损伤情况。本调查的目的是就产后跑步且有肌肉骨骼疼痛的跑步者所报告损伤的特征达成专家共识。

方法

开展了一项基于网络的德尔菲调查,该调查由五个类别组成:力量、活动范围、排列和灵活性损伤,以及产后跑步者疼痛的风险因素。

结果

共邀请了117位专家。45位专家完成了第一轮调查,41位专家完成了第二轮和第三轮调查。达成共识的力量损伤为腹部、髋部和盆底肌无力。达成共识的活动范围损伤为髋部伸展受限、骨盆前倾和全身关节活动过度。达成共识的排列损伤为臀中肌步态、动态膝外翻、腰椎前凸、过度内旋和胸椎后凸。达成共识的灵活性损伤为腹壁松弛,以及髋屈肌、腰伸肌、髂胫束和腘绳肌紧张。产后跑步者疼痛的风险因素为肌肉失衡、腰骨盆控制不佳、操之过急、生活压力源、孕期疼痛和盆底创伤。

结论

本研究为临床医生理解产后跑步者的疼痛提供了一个框架,可在未来的队列研究中进行调查。
